Output dd3b02a8295b0a27be67472279d75561f73a96b892cc70731493ee85f3d20f28:2

value
5253270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d017bc60772fa4960e2004dce93be846de374140 OP_EQUAL
address
3LfJue5M22YVAs44ijwyHymxmq9Bpcjjhs
transaction
dd3b02a8295b0a27be67472279d75561f73a96b892cc70731493ee85f3d20f28
spent
true